Transaction 71e16c1d86a5079d12440143b3b19e7a709454ca1f4b5e71e219b9421efa72fb

4 Input
1 Outputs
  • 71e16c1d86a5079d12440143b3b19e7a709454ca1f4b5e71e219b9421efa72fb:0
  • value  598858
    address  3QvfctvCJdac9KoYDD29gQKxnKnz3j3GVx